Methods
| Modifier and Type |
Method and Description |
void |
addClient(SocketIOClient client) |
void |
addConnectListener(ConnectListener listener) |
void |
addDisconnectListener(DisconnectListener listener) |
<T> void |
addEventListener(String eventName,
Class<T> eventClass,
DataListener<T> listener) |
<T> void |
addJsonObjectListener(Class<T> clazz,
DataListener<T> listener) |
void |
addListeners(Object listeners) |
void |
addListeners(Object listeners,
Class listenersClass) |
void |
addMessageListener(DataListener<String> listener) |
void |
addMultiTypeEventListener(String eventName,
MultiTypeEventListener listener,
Class<?>... eventClass) |
void |
dispatch(String room,
Packet packet) |
boolean |
equals(Object obj) |
BroadcastOperations |
getBroadcastOperations() |
Queue<DataListener<String>> |
getMessageListeners() |
String |
getName() |
Iterable<SocketIOClient> |
getRoomClients(String room) |
List<String> |
getRooms(SocketIOClient client) |
int |
hashCode() |
boolean |
isEmpty() |
void |
join(String room,
UUID sessionId) |
void |
joinRoom(String room,
UUID sessionId) |
void |
leave(String room,
UUID sessionId) |
void |
leaveRoom(String room,
UUID sessionId) |
void |
onConnect(SocketIOClient client) |
void |
onDisconnect(SocketIOClient client) |
void |
onEvent(NamespaceClient client,
String eventName,
List<Object> args,
AckRequest ackRequest) |
void |
onJsonObject(NamespaceClient client,
Object data,
AckRequest ackRequest) |
void |
onMessage(NamespaceClient client,
String data,
AckRequest ackRequest) |